Adaptive Biotechnologies Corp

ADPT trades at $24.93, up 5.64% in 24 hours and near its 52-week high. The stock shows bullish technical momentum with improving fundamentals as revenue grew 55% year-over-year to $277M in 2025 while net losses narrowed significantly from -$159M to -$59M. The company's strategic shift to focus on its profitable MRD diagnostics business through a planned separation of Immune Medicine operations has driven investor optimism.

Outlook remains cautiously optimistic as ADPT transitions to a pure-play MRD company with strong gross margins exceeding 75%. While analyst consensus favors Buy ratings (65%), persistent net losses and high valuation multiples (P/S 12.6x, P/B 27.8x) present risks. The $25.50 price target suggests limited upside from current levels amid execution risks.

Manulife Financial Corporation

Manulife Financial (MFC) trades at $44.32, down 0.58% with a bullish technical outlook supported by moving averages. The company reported strong Q2 2026 results with double-digit growth in Asia and insurance sales, beating EPS expectations. Revenue reached $53.01B in 2025 with net income of $5.78B, though profit margins have moderated from 2022 peaks. Analysts maintain a Moderate Buy consensus with 57% buy ratings.

MFC presents a positive investment case with solid earnings growth, expanding Asian operations, and consistent dividend payments. However, premium valuation metrics and moderating profit margins warrant caution. The stock faces risks from wealth management outflows and competitive pressures in core markets, requiring careful monitoring of Q3 earnings performance.

About Adaptive Biotechnologies Corp

Adaptive Biotechnologies Corp is a commercial-stage company advancing the field of immune-driven medicine by harnessing the inherent biology of the adaptive immune system to transform the diagnosis and treatment of disease. Its clinical diagnostic product, clonoSEQ, is test authorized by the FDA for the detection and monitoring of minimal residual disease in patients with select blood cancers.

About Manulife Financial Corporation

Manulife provides life insurance and wealth management products and services to individuals and group customers in Canada, the United States, and Asia. Manulife is one of Canada's Big Three Life Insurance companies (the other two are Sun Life and Great West Life). As of Dec. 31, 2021, Manulife reported assets under management or administration of about CAD $1.4 trillion.
